In Australia it appears they're changing public messaging on vaccination for <30 yrs due to increased risk of myocarditis and lack of notable benefits[1]:

"One of the nation’s top advisers on vaccination says it is unlikely young people under 30 will be approved for fourth doses, as Australia turns its attention to antiviral access to tackle yet another Omicron wave."

"Former ATAGI co-chair and current member Professor Allen Cheng said the increased risk of myocarditis and the lack of notable benefit from additional boosters meant it was likely the recommended vaccine schedule for younger people would remain as is. Some are approaching a year since their booster shot."
